The Holiday Home is a 16th century mansion in the already impressive protected area of the Rijeka Dubrovačka.
It is located in one of the most beautiful parts of the Mediterranean, boasting unique views of the Dubrovnik Sea.
You might be hundreds of kilometers away from your home, but your universe is now here and you're at its centre.

You are at the sea, 200 m from bus station, 200 m from grocery, 10 km from Dubrovnik Old City, 25 km from the airport.

An absolute gem of a historical seaside house in Dubrovnik
We stayed four nights in Matej's totally charming, centuries old house, and it was perfect for our family of five. The house has a huge garden - and I mean really huge - that also has two turtles strolling around. We had some really wonderful al fresco dinners, grilling local fish. But even better than the garden was the fact that the house is situated literally by the sea and you could basically jump into it literally out of the front gate. Matej also kindly helped to organize a boat for us, and we spent four hours on the sea exploring the famous blue cave on one nearby island as well as having picnic in the port of the Dubrovnik Old Town. Initially we were a bit concerned by the house's somewhat "remote" location, remote meaning that it's not in the Old Town. However, understanding now better the local situation, I think the location is actually great as long as one has a car. Everything is just minutes away, and the village of Mokosica has a very different local charm compared to the touristic Old Town. We are very grateful to Matiej and his wife for the opportunity to stay in their house, absolutely recommend it to anybody, and certainly will come back.
